Transaction 3c6caa4d33fbcbfd003438e926bbf50b03667743a8599a50133495244abd06ea
1 Input
1 Output
-
3c6caa4d33fbcbfd003438e926bbf50b03667743a8599a50133495244abd06ea:0
- value
- 383214
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0eb3d709bc410b0c356e83b9f89484d3acb649aa OP_EQUAL
- address
- 332kpjMh83iDcQurD1ddiQAzVBxG6EfepZ